Team Timeline tells the company story as the people who joined it. A heading and one line lede sit above a vertical rail of year entries, each carrying a milestone title, a short story, and an overlapping avatar group of the people who came aboard that year. A dot on the left rail marks each chapter down the line.
The entries are one array of year, title, story, caption, and a list of joiners with portraits, rendered as an ordered list on a bordered rail. The avatar stacks use a background matched ring so the faces read as a group in both themes. Four chapters pace the rail well, though it accepts any count. Everything follows the collection conventions, tokens, borders, and the shared avatar set.
Reach for this block on an about page telling growth through hiring, companies whose story is really the story of who showed up. Pairing each milestone with the faces who joined answers how did you get here in a way a stat strip cannot. It goes deeper than the roster where team-grid-with-avatars shows only the present team.
